Abstract

According to one embodiment, a pattern data creating method includes a calculation process, a determination process, and a correction process. In the calculation process, it is calculated a stress distribution of stresses that are applied to a template when a distance between the template and a substrate on which resist are disposed is predetermined, the template including a template pattern. In the determination process, it is determined whether or not there is a stress concentration spot in the template pattern at which a stress value larger than a predetermined criterion value is to appear. If the stress concentration spot is present, in the correction process, it is a corrected pattern data of the template pattern such that the stress value at the stress concentration spot becomes a stress value not larger than the predetermined criterion value.
